Read more...The Indian leather industry accounts for around 12.93% of the world's leather production of hides/skins. India's leather industry has grown drastically, transforming from a mere raw material supplier to a value-added product exporter. Total leather and leather products export from India stood at US$ 5.07 billion in 2019-20.

Read more...Jul 12, 2020· India has 12 major ports -- Kandla, Mumbai, JNPT, Mormugao, New Mangalore, Cochin, Chennai, Kamarajar (Ennore), VO Chidambaranar, Visakhapatnam, Paradip and Kolkata (including Haldia) -- that handle about 61 per cent of the country's total cargo traffic. These 12 ports had handled 705 MT of cargo in the last financial year. more
